What is the 855B? ❖ The CMS form used for the enrollment of Clinic/Group practices and Certain Other Suppliers. This form is also used to submit changes to your enrollment data.

CMS-855I: For employed physician assistants (sections 1, 2, 3, 13, and 15). CMS-855R: Individuals reassigning (entire application). CMS-855O: All eligible physicians and non-physician practitioners (entire application). Same applications are required as those of new enrollees.

CMS 855B. Form Title. Medicare Enrollment Application - Clinics/Group Practices and Certain Other Suppliers.
All physicians, as well as all eligible professionals as defined in section 1848(k)(3)(B) of the Social Security Act must complete this application to enroll in the Medicare program and receive a Medicare billing number.
CMS 855O. Form Title. Medicare Enrollment Application - Registration For Eligible Ordering and Referring Physicians and Non-Physician Practitioners.
The difference between enrolling a practice using an 855I and 855B is the reporting of ownership information. When one individual owns the whole practice, Medicare can utilize the 855I to verify that the owner meets Medicare requirements.
